Trail Day 1

Last night I slept in a comfortable bed.  Tonight I'll be somewhere on the forest floor.  Ryan dropped me off at the Bridge of the Gods Oregon around 9:30.  I choked up in tears as I crossed.  I am back on the PCT.  The Columbia River swept under me.
I wove my way around and up along side Table Top Mountain.  Met a novice section hiker who was struggling.  I saw him at the next water, haven'tseen him since.  Some where along the way I pulled a muscle, arugh.  Every time I stubled from then on I cursed a moment.

I stopped around my mile 8 about 2:30 still climibing. I drank a Nuun tablet to rehydration and crashed out for a nap.  Refreshed I carried on.  I had 2 1/2 ltrs of water.
PCT 2161.8 I stoped for dinner at 6:30.  A near by spring is dry.  The next water source is 2.5 miles.  I have 1 ltr left after making dinner.

I've come 17.8 miles today.  Not bad for day 1 but, I'd like to clean up.  My legs scream stay.  I sit at the edge of an od clear cut.  Young trees crowd together.  A wood pecker raps on one of the few old standing trees.  Plenty of day light left and its down hill to the next water and camp sites.  I'm gona take a first day 20.

For those watching my SPOTs, yes, I did sleep on the side of a well groomed dirt road.  Had the stars for company and the heat as a blanket.  Eventually, I did slip my feet into my quilt.  The water was scarce and the campsites even more so from where I stopped for dinner, hence the road.
